Statkraft is developing osmotic power as a new renewable energy technology. Osmotic power uses osmosis, the natural process by which water moves from a low salt concentration to a high one, to generate electricity. Statkraft has built a prototype osmotic power plant in Norway to test membrane and system components at a small scale. The technology has potential for cost reductions through larger membrane elements, higher system efficiencies, and economies of scale in larger plants. Statkraft is working with partners on membrane and system development to advance osmotic power toward commercialization.

The business models of OTT platforms are explored in detail. Subscription Video on Demand (SVOD) models, exemplified by Netflix and Amazon Prime Video, offer unlimited content access for a monthly fee. Transactional Video on Demand (TVOD) models, like iTunes and Sky Box Office, allow users to pay for individual pieces of content. Advertising-Based Video on Demand (AVOD) models, such as YouTube and Facebook Watch, provide free content supported by advertisements. Hybrid models combine elements of SVOD and AVOD, offering flexibility to cater to diverse audience preferences.
